I have a question regarding 4.8.5 - Environmental Monitoring for Footwear Control.
The standard says that:
"There shall be an effective control of footwear to prevent the introduction of pathogens into high-care areas. This may be by a controlled change of footwear before entering the area or by the use of controlled and managed boot-wash facilities.
A programme of environmental monitoring shall be established to assess the effectiveness of footwear controls."
What do others have in place to comply with this requirement? What would be environmental testing that could assess the effectiveness of footwear controls?
